Output 23d36bf5c9f14f7b34375871c61505a991b64f5ebfc55e726c69a6c7af2f9a02:0

value
628280549
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42e2b6973fb5c0694f17da99fd64f945f5037156 OP_EQUALVERIFY OP_CHECKSIG
address
176fByT2Ke6v9L6t6kvH2Ka6nY9qaeBfJi
transaction
23d36bf5c9f14f7b34375871c61505a991b64f5ebfc55e726c69a6c7af2f9a02
spent
true